Weather in September

September, the first month of the autumn in Broughton, is still a warm month, with an average temperature varying between 84.2°F (29°C) and 64.6°F (18.1°C).

Temperature

During September, Broughton observes a subtle ascent to a warm 84.2°F (29°C) from August's 88.5°F (31.4°C) in the average high-temperature. In Broughton, the September nights cool down to an average low of 64.6°F (18.1°C).

Heat index

The heat index for September is computed to be a tropical 91.4°F (33°C). Greater safety measures are needed, risk of heat exhaustion and heat cramps is high. Continuous activity might trigger heatstroke.
Heat index details are generally centered around shaded locations and a mild breeze. When under direct sunshine, the heat index may be elevated by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'feels like' or 'apparent temperature', determines the feeling of heat when you account for the relative humidity. The experience of temperature can be subjective, varying based on the individual's activity and heat perception, influenced by factors like wind, attire, and metabolic variations. One should be aware that direct sunshine can amplify the perceived temperature, raising the heat index by as much as 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are largely significant for babies and toddlers. Children usually face more risks than adults as their ability to sweat is less. Additionally, their larger skin surface in relation to their petite bodies and higher heat output due to their activities increases their vulnerability.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in September in Broughton is 74%.

Rainfall

In September, in Broughton, the rain falls for 14.1 days. Throughout September, 2.36" (60mm) of precipitation is accumulated. Throughout the year, there are 181.7 rainfall days, and 39.06" (992m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

April through November are months without snowfall.

Daylight

In September, the average length of the day in Broughton is 12h and 22min.
On the first day of September in Broughton, sunrise is at 6:16 am and sunset at 7:06 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:35 am and sunset at 6:27 pm CDT.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in September in Broughton is 8.5h.

UV index

In Broughton, the average daily maximum UV index in September is 5. A UV Index of 3 to 5 symbolizes a medium health hazard from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for ordinary individuals.
Note: The maximum daily UV index of 5 during September translates into the following directions:
Take measures. Individuals with light skin might experience burns in under 30 minutes. The Sun's UV radiation is especially harmful around midday, so reduce exposure and stay safe. On sunny days, it's ideal to wear sunglasses that filter out UVA and UVB rays.
